Chilled Water CIP provides for the expansion, improvement and replacement of infrastructure required to generate and deliver chilled water to customers in the downtown and Port San Antonio areas. The 2024 CIP program totals $567.6 million and is summarized in the table below. 2024 Capital Improvement Program. Core Business Area.

We will monitor your account for approximately 60 - 90 days to confirm that your repair has resulted in reduced water use. At the end of that time, we will review your account and send you a letter detailing your adjustment, or, if no adjustment was given, explaining the reason why.

To protect the system, backflow prevention assemblies (devices that prevent the backflow of water) are required for all connections that may present a potential source of contamination to the public water system. For approximately $10-$20, the average homeowner can install two low-flow shower heads, install low-flow aerators on faucets and repair dripping faucets and leaking toilets. This could save 10,000-25,000 gallons per year for a family of four, and would pay for itself ...Stage 4. Back-siphonage is backflow caused by negative pressure (i.e. vacuum or partial vacuum) in a public water system or customer’s potable water system. The effect is similar to drinking water through a straw. Back-siphonage can occur when there is a stoppage of water supply due to nearby fire fighting, a break in a water main, etc.

A-Tunneling We Will Go. Feb 1, 2022. In the wee morning hours of Dec. 16, a giant boring machine completed a 12-foot tunnel spanning about three miles along Military Drive from Old Pearsall Road to U.S. Highway 90. It's the longest tunnel segment of SAWS' massive sewer replacement project near Joint Base San Antonio-Lackland.

Puente was appointed San Antonio Water System's President and CEO in May 2008. As chief executive of one of the nation's largest utilities, he provides leadership in delivering water and wastewater services to more than 1.7 million consumers, developing new water resources, continuing infrastructure upgrades throughout the community, and building regional partnerships. Before ...Service Areas. San Antonio Water System serves 2 million people in Bexar County as well as parts of Medina and Atascosa counties. The population includes more than 511,300 water customers and 457,600 wastewater customers. SAWS Water Service Area SAWS Sewer Area. SAWS service areas are established by its permits from state regulatory authorities.For more information, contact SAWS Cares at 210-704-SAWS and ask to be referred to a SAWS Cares representative, or send your request/inquiry to: Email: [email protected]. Gate valves shall be placed every 1,000 feet per SAWS criteria and at locations necessary to isolate the water distribution system. 18. Water mains that are not part of an interconnecting system must be a minimum, 8-inch water main.

In 2023, approximately 49% (~163,000 AF) of water used by SAWS customers came from the Edwards Aquifer. The Edwards Aquifer Authority (EAA) issued water rights through an established permitting process, and today, SAWS goal is to maintain approximately 281,000 AFY of those rights.. Last Digit of Street Address Watering Day 0 or 1 Monday 2 or 3 Tuesday 4 or 5 Wednesday 6 or 7 Thursday 8 or 9 Friday No watering on weekends with a sprinkler, soaker hose or irrigation system.
